So we have two twins in board however what is the actual difference between you must be asking, well my little dumpling the NC2 has a 140mm fan generating a sizeable 80cfm at an unknown rpm.

 

So you arent impressed, but wait you will be i hope because id elder brother, the NS1000 has something special. It has a 180mm fan with a sucking rating of 130cfm with also an unknown rpm.

Back on topic the NS1000 has dual usb2.0 inputs, you get a pass through so it links to your laptop and powers the fan

 

There is then an analog fan controller so you can change between 550rpm and 1500rpm there is a give or take 15% range of error here which is pretty normal with fans. 

 

NS1000_07.jpg

Both are designed for laptops up to the size of 16inchs, there isnt really a change there.
